Am putting together box of things that feel interesting for my 9 month old ds. Have got already piece of lace, silk, felt, cotton, a shower puff thing. Thought I'd get a new wooden spoon. Any other ideas?

in my feely box i have:
shaving brush
rubber gloves
spoons
plastic cups
mirrors
fabic
toothbrush
feely books
bean bags
beads (wooden and plastic)
comb
balti dish
wooden dishes
teddy
ribbon
bambo dinner mat
wooden ball
garlic press
plastic flowers
empty salt and pepper pots
pan
tubberware tubs
old mobile phone

prob got more but cant think at mo

My DD has special needs so our OT always used to get her to touch stuff like:

dried pasta, penne, fussilli etc

mix up cornflour and water. (is that right???) It's like liquid but you can pick it up, am I making any sense at all???

water with sand in bottom and bury things in sand. (can also do this without water on top)

OPther ideas

  • stress ball
  • those plastic pom pom thignbs
  • a scourer
  • cotton wool
